About
Genetic counselors work with patients to help them understand and adapt to the medical, psychological, and familial implications of genetic disorders. In my own practice, I aim to provide personalized genetics education while recognizing genetic conditions and genetic testing can often be confusing, complicated, and uncomfortable. I work to provide a supportive space that allows us to explore these questions and emotions to better understand how they may affect complex medical decision-making. Together, my goal is to make patients feel included in and knowledgeable about their medical care. Nobody deserves to navigate a genetic diagnosis alone, and I am thankful to be on a team that consistently works towards preventing this.
